- >: Is there ANY way to run external commands from my config.sys file? There
- >: must be some utility program out there that can do this...
- >:
- >I'm not quite sure and don't have a chance to test, but how about
- >the INSTALL-command in CONFIG.SYS frequently used to start some
- >TSRs from there? I recommend you take a look at your documentation
- >whether it only handles TSRs or even 'normal' programs. If so, it
- >should solve your problem (I hope ... ;-I)
-
- Yes I tried this (thanks to the help of a personal reply), and it worked. I
- don't now why I forgot about it since I used it a year or so ago to solve
- another strange problem. Thanks again.
